National Schemes & Policies in News 🏛️

During the 80th Independence Day address, the Prime Minister highlighted the transformative success of the Jal Jeevan Mission (JJM), which has completed seven years of implementation. The mission has achieved a significant milestone, increasing rural drinking water tap coverage from a mere 16.7% in 2019 to over 82% in 2026. Additionally, the PM Vishwakarma Scheme was in the spotlight as its beneficiaries were invited as 'Special Guests' to the Red Fort, symbolizing the government's commitment to traditional artisans.

Static GK Highlight: The Jal Jeevan Mission was launched on August 15, 2019, under the Ministry of Jal Shakti. Its primary objective is to provide Safe and Adequate drinking water through Individual Household Tap Connections (FHTC) to all households in rural India by 2024 (extended targets apply for saturation).

Exam-Oriented Current Affairs & Key Facts 📝

  • Science & Technology: The Prime Minister announced a new initiative to provide AI (Artificial Intelligence) skilling to 1 crore youth within a single year to prepare the workforce for the future economy.
  • Polity & Governance: India celebrated its 80th Independence Day on August 15, 2026. The theme focused on 'Raksha Shakti' and the vision of 'Viksit Bharat' (Developed India) by 2047.
  • Economy: Social security coverage in India has witnessed a record expansion, growing from 25 crore beneficiaries a decade ago to 100 crore beneficiaries in 2026.
  • International Relations: The SURYAPATH TIRANGA GLOBAL RELAY, a maritime and cultural initiative, has successfully covered 40 countries, showcasing India's global outreach.
  • Reports & Indices: NITI Aayog released a report titled "India’s Services Sector: Insights on Regulatory Regime in Professional Services," focusing on streamlining regulations for professionals like lawyers, accountants, and engineers.
  • Defence: Gallantry awards and honorary ranks were conferred upon personnel of the Indian Army, Navy (COAS and VCOAS Commendations), and IAF on the eve of Independence Day.
